NATA Admit Card 2026

NATA Admit Card 2026: The Council of Architecture (CoA) will release the NATA admit card 2026 on Wednesday and Thursday for Friday and Saturday exam sessions, respectively. NATA exam 2026 will be conducted in multiple sessions starting from March 2026 till July 2026. For each session, the CoA will release the NATA admit card 2026 on the official portal at www.nata.in. Candidates can download the NATA admit card using their login credentials. 

NATA 2026 is conducted by the Council of Architecture (COA) for admission to undergraduate architecture programs (B.Arch) across India. The test will be conducted online and covers both drawing and theoretical questions over a three-hour duration.

 

How to Download NATA Admit Card 2026 If Login Credentials are Forgotten?

For NATA admit card download, you must have your application number and password. In case you forget your login credentials, the following steps can be taken. 

  • Refer to the official website at nata.in.
  • Browse the homepage. Click on the “Forgot Application Number and Password” link. 
  • A window appears. Enter your name, registered mobile number, email address, and date of birth. 
  • Answer a few security questions that were set during the NATA 2026 registration process. 
  • After you answer the questions correctly, you will receive the new NATA login credentials on your registered email address and mobile number. 
  • For NATA admit card 2026 login, use these new credentials now and download the admit card. 

If you still have trouble, check your spam and junk folders in your email for any messages containing your login information. If you can’t find them, reach out to the NATA helpdesk for support.

NATA Exam Centres 2026

The CoA will notify about the NATA exam centres 2026 once the official NATA 2026 notification is released. It will include a wide network of exam centres in major cities such as Delhi, Mumbai, Chennai, Kolkata, and regional hubs including Guntur, Guwahati, and Bhopal. Candidates need to select three exam cities in order of priority during the NATA 2026 application process. Final allotment will be based on the availability and capacity of the exam centres. 

NATA Exam Day Instructions 2026

The Council of Architecture (CoA) has laid down certain exam day guidelines for a hassle-free exam experience. Here are some prominent instructions. 

  • Make sure you reach the NATA exam centre 2026 before the reporting time for your session. Latecomers will not be allowed in under any circumstances.
  • Carry your NATA admit card 2026 along with a valid government-issued photo ID, such as an Aadhaar Card, PAN Card, Passport, Voter ID, or Driver’s License for verification. 
  • Prohibited items, such as electronic gadgets, such as watches, calculators, must not be avoided. 
  • Follow the exam day instructions given by the invigilators and stay in the examination room until the exam ends. 

 

NATA Admit Card 2026 FAQs

When will the NATA admit card 2026 be released?

NATA admit card 2026 will be released on the official website at nata.in 2-3 days before every NATA exam 2026 session. Generally, it gets released on Wednesday and Thursday for Friday and Saturday NATA sessions.

How to download NATA 2026 admit card?

Candidates can download the NATA admit card 2026 by visiting the official website. Enter your NATA 2026 application number and password to download it.

What information is present on the NATA admit card?

Important details such as candidate's name,  photograph, roll number, allotted test centre, session, appointment number, and exam day instructions are provided on the NATA admit card 2026.

What other documents should I bring along with the NATA 2026 admit card?

Candidates need to bring a valid government-issued photo ID proof (such as Aadhaar Card, PAN Card, Passport, Voter ID, or Driver’s License) and permitted stationery.

What should I do if I find an error on my NATA admit card 2026?

If there is any mistake or incorrect information on your NATA 2026 admit card, immediately contact the NATA helpdesk for correction before the exam date.
